Striker Julián Carranza Joins Leicester City On Loan
Exciting forward Julián Carranza has joined the Leicester City ranks on a season-long loan from Dutch Eredivisie side Feyenoord, subject to international and league clearance.

  • Argentinian striker Julián Carranza joins Leicester City on loan
  • The 25-year-old signs from Dutch Eredivisie side Feyenoord
  • He has also spent time playing in Major League Soccer in the United States
The 25-year-old made 30 appearances for the Rotterdam club in all competitions last term, including seven in the UEFA Champions League, after an impressive four-year spell in Major League Soccer.
Speaking on Foxes Hub, he said: “I’m really happy and really excited to be here. I’m thankful for this opportunity so I cannot wait to get started.
“When the opportunity came up, of course I didn’t have any single doubt about it. We all know what Leicester City is as a team, and as an institution as well, so when the opportunity came, I was really excited for it.
“I have some experience in different places. Of course, this is a new experience as well. Everyone wants to play in England. Every single player wants to play here, so I’m really excited and I can’t wait to get started.
“I’ve been watching Leicester for a long time so, as I said, I know the team, I know the institution as well. We all know around the world what this team is. When the opportunity came up, I had no doubts about it.”
Carranza was born in Argentina and started his career at Argentine Primera División side Banfield, before making the switch to MLS side Inter Miami in 2019.
He spent four years in the MLS with The Herons and Philadelphia Union, racking up a total of 37 goals and 15 assists from 115 regular season matches in the United States, becoming a key part of the side that finished runners-up in the 2022 MLS Cup.
Julián’s performances earned him a move to the Eredivisie in the summer of 2024, where his goals in his debut campaign helped Feyenoord to a third-place finish in the league, as well as the knockout phases of the UEFA Champions League.
He will now link up with his Leicester City team-mates who are next in action against Oxford United in the Sky Bet Championship on Saturday 13 September (12:30pm kick-off).
